Aamir Khan and Rajkumar Hirani, the acclaimed director-actor duo, are set to embark on a new cinematic journey: a biopic dedicated to Dadasaheb Phalke, the "Father of Indian cinema." This project aims to bring the extraordinary story of the man who laid the foundation for India's vast and influential film industry to the big screen.
Dadasaheb Phalke's contribution to Indian cinema is monumental. He is credited with creating India's first full-length feature film, Raja Harishchandra, in 1913. His pioneering efforts and unwavering passion paved the way for generations of filmmakers and established a cinematic legacy that continues to thrive. Despite his pivotal role, a comprehensive cinematic portrayal of his life has been surprisingly absent from Hindi cinema.
The upcoming biopic will unfold against the backdrop of India's independence struggle, adding a historical dimension to Phalke's personal journey. It will chronicle his remarkable rise from humble beginnings, highlighting the immense challenges he faced and the sheer determination that drove him to establish what would become one of the world's largest film industries. The film promises to be a powerful narrative of artistic vision triumphing over adversity.
Filming is scheduled to commence in October 2025. Aamir Khan, known for his meticulous approach to his roles, will begin his preparations following the release of his film, Sitaare Zameen Par. To ensure an authentic depiction of the era, VFX studios in Los Angeles are already developing AI-assisted designs. This will help recreate the visual landscape and atmosphere of the time period in which Phalke worked.
Rajkumar Hirani, celebrated for his ability to blend compelling storytelling with social commentary, has been developing the script for this ambitious project over the past four years. He is collaborating with his frequent writing partner, Abhijat Joshi, along with Hindukush Bharadwaj and Avishkar Bharadwaj. This collaborative effort aims to deliver a nuanced and engaging narrative that captures the essence of Dadasaheb Phalke's life and work.

Adding further depth and authenticity to the project is the involvement of Dadasaheb Phalke's grandson, Chandrashekhar Srikrishna Pusalkar. He has reportedly been providing valuable insights and sharing personal anecdotes about his grandfather, which will undoubtedly enrich the film's portrayal of the legendary filmmaker.
The collaboration between Aamir Khan and Rajkumar Hirani has consistently yielded both critical acclaim and commercial success. Their previous ventures, such as 3 Idiots and PK, have become modern classics, celebrated for their storytelling, performances, and ability to connect with a broad audience.
